Step 1: Initial Assessment

Our technicians will arrive quickly to assess the situation and identify the source of the water damage. They'll take notes and photos to document the extent of the damage. Thorough, efficient assessment.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We'll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to extract the water from the affected area. This step is crucial to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th. Fast, effective water removal.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We'll use specialized equipment to dry the affected area,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This step is critical to prevent secondary damage and ensure a thorough dry. Thorough, effective drying.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ting

We'll use eco-friendly cleaning solutions to disinfect the affected area, removing any remaining water and bacteria. This step is essential to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. Safe, effective cleaning.

Step 5: Repair and Reconstruction

Our team will repair any structural damage, including replacing drywall, flooring, and other affected materials. We'll work with you to ensure the repairs meet your needs and budget. Quality repairs, guaranteed.

Bathroom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om fixture Yes No You can fix small leaks yourself with basic tools and DIY guides.
Large flood in a bathroom due to a pipe burst No Yes A large flood need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ively remove the water and repair the damage.
Hidden water damage behind bathroom walls No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ively locate and repair the damage.
Musty odors in a bathroom due to a hidden water issue No Yes Musty odors can show hidden water damage or mold growth, which need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ively locate and repair.
Water damage to a bathroom's structural parts (e.g., flooring, walls) No Yes Water damage to structural parts need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ively repair and replace.
Excessive water damage or multiple areas affected No Yes Excessive water damage or multiple areas affected need spec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ively remove the water, clean and disinfect the area, and repair any structural damage.

Bathroom Water Removal Cost in Mobile, AL

The cost of Bathroom Water Removal can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mobile, AL. These are estimates, not guarantees. Get a personalized quote today.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 - $2,500 The cost of water extraction and removal can vary widely depending on the amount of water and the equipment needed to remove it.
Drying and dehumidification $200 - $1,500 The cost of drying and dehumidification can vary widely depending on the size of the affected area and the equipment needed to dry it.
Cleaning and disinfecting $100 - $1,000 The cost of cleaning and disinfecting can vary widely depending on the size of the affected area and the cleaning solutions needed.
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 - $10,000 The cost of repair and reconstruction can vary widely depending on the ext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air.
